Trees Covered By Giant Spider Webs In Pakistan
Whoa. This is what happened when Pakistani spiders were forced to seek higher ground during the 2010 floods.

You know the rover that NASA sent to Mars on Saturday (11-26-11)? Here's a pretty sweet animated clip showing what we can expect when “Curiosity” lands on the Red Planet in August 2012. Via: blog.sirmitchell.com
